Sir, the Dental Council of India (DCI) has offered a solution to the acute shortage of medical doctors and specialists in India. It has proposed to start a bridge course for dental graduates so that they can become an MBBS doctor. There is already a bridge course for MBBS doctors who would like to become a dentist. The DCI president Dr D. Majumder has suggested a bridge course to help dental graduates to become MBBS doctors.
In India over 85% of positions for physicians are vacant at community health centres, yet more than 15,000 dental graduates are jobless. The bridge course would be a good solution to both problems.1
